String Dimensions

String Dimensions, founded by Bogdan Vacarescu in 2017, is a London-based chamber ensemble of international soloists.

String Dimensions is no ordinary chamber ensemble. United by a mutual interest in performing music all too rarely heard in today’s concert programmes, they have given the UK premieres of Antonio Bazzini’s works and perform neglected repertoire such as Fritz Kreisler’s String Quartet and works by Enescu and Cherubini. Their programmes also include original arrangements of well-known classical works for string duos, trios, quartets and larger groups.

The ensemble features Allegri Quartet cellist Vanessa Lucas-Smith, Canadian violist Brooke Day, Japanese violinist Akiko Ishikawa and it is led by the Romanian violinist Bogdan Vacarescu.

They all perform internationally in the most prestigious festivals and venues such as London’s Kings Place, Sydney Opera House, Cheltenham Music and Melbourne International Arts Festivals, as well as on radio and television worldwide.

Waterlow Park Geotrail @ Lauderdale House
Feb 22 @ 12:00 pm – 12:45 pm

In partnership with the London Geodiversity Partnership, we are delighted to offer a free Waterlow Park Geotrail as part of our Heritage Weekend. Join us as we learn how the geology of Waterlow Park relates to its layout and local development from the London Geodiversity Partnership.

The Geotrail will be led by Diana Clements. Diana has lived in Islington for many years and brought her children to Waterlow Park when they were young where they enjoyed rolling around in the mud produced from the springs on the slope. In 1995, she curated a temporary exhibition for the Islington Museum, then in Upper Street: Beneath Our Feet: the Geology of Islington. Since 1990 she has worked in the Natural History Museum and in 2010 compiled a Geologists’ Association Guide to the Geology of London (revised 2023). She has been able to continue her passion for the geology of London by becoming an active member of the London Geodiversity Partnership.
